what were the two regions that made up ancient egypt

Respuesta :

dinoucamilus0 dinoucamilus0
  • 16-10-2019

Ancient Egypt was divided into two regions, namely Upper Egypt and Lower Egypt. To the north was Lower Egypt, where the Nile stretched out with its several branches to form the Nile Delta. To the south was Upper Egypt, stretching to Syene.
